Housing content Deep Dive: Aluminum vs. Solid Iron/Composite

the fabric used for the drinking water pump housing is arguably the most important differentiator, influencing pounds, warmth transfer, corrosion resistance, and manufacturing strategies.

Weight and Thermal Conductivity:

oFREY (Aluminum Alloy): Aluminum's Most important gain is its substantially lower density in comparison with Solid iron. This translates on to weight personal savings – a little but cumulative benefit for Total motor vehicle excess weight, perhaps contributing to marginal gas financial state improvements and a bit improved dealing with dynamics. additional critically, aluminum features outstanding thermal conductivity. What this means is the FREY pump housing itself can dissipate heat far more efficiently and quickly transfer warmth within the motor block into the coolant, aiding the cooling method's In general efficiency, especially in the course of significant-load operation or in very hot climates.

oRM European (Forged Iron/Composite): Forged iron is significantly heavier, incorporating extra mass on the engine assembly. While strong, its thermal conductivity is decreased than aluminum's, this means the housing itself contributes considerably less to warmth dissipation. Composite housings provide a middle ground, lighter than iron but possibly considerably less conductive than aluminum, although supplying good corrosion resistance and style flexibility. Forged iron's mass, having said that, does lend it inherent vibration damping Qualities.

Corrosion and Fatigue Resistance:

oFREY (Aluminum Alloy): Aluminum In a natural way types a passive oxide layer (aluminum oxide) upon publicity to air, offering inherent corrosion resistance. even so, aluminum alloys might be at risk of pitting corrosion or galvanic corrosion (if improperly mounted with dissimilar metals without appropriate coolant inhibitors) about prolonged intervals, particularly if coolant top quality degrades. To fight this, substantial-excellent aluminum pumps like FREY's frequently integrate protective surface treatments (discussed later on). Aluminum frequently exhibits good fatigue resistance under standard running stresses.

oRM European (Cast Iron/Composite): Forged iron's Major vulnerability is rust (iron oxide) In case the coolant's anti-corrosion additives are depleted or the incorrect coolant style is utilized. correct cooling system maintenance is important. nevertheless, cast iron is extremely proof against effects and abrasion, making it quite strong bodily. Its exhaustion existence is normally superb below regular situations. Composite housings are inherently resistant to rust and several forms of chemical corrosion found in cooling units, offering a durable substitute, although their very long-expression resistance to warmth biking and probable brittleness as compared to steel demands thing to consider.

Manufacturing course of action and style:

oFREY (Aluminum Alloy): Aluminum alloys are very well-suited for contemporary die-casting procedures. This enables to the generation of sophisticated inside stream passages and slim-walled constructions with higher precision. This precision can improve coolant circulation dynamics throughout the pump, possibly improving hydraulic performance and contributing to raised overall cooling effectiveness.

oRM European (Forged Iron/Composite): Solid iron housings are usually manufactured employing sand casting, a mature and cost-efficient strategy ideal for significant-volume creation. although able of manufacturing complicated styles, it may well provide a little bit considerably less precision in intricate inside aspects when compared with die-casting aluminum. Composite housings tend to be injection molded, making it possible for important style flexibility and most likely decrease producing prices than casting steel.

Sealing Technology: The Leak Prevention Battleground

The seal is the water pump's Achilles' heel. protecting against coolant leaks is paramount, and sealing technological innovation has evolved considerably.

The Evolution of Seals: Early drinking water pumps relied on simple packing or standard lip seals. Later, paper or cork gaskets were being popular for sealing the pump housing for the engine block. Modern models predominantly use sophisticated mechanical experience seals coupled with elastomeric O-rings or bellows.

FREY (Modern Multi-Layer/Sophisticated Elastomer Seals): FREY emphasizes the use of fashionable sealing alternatives, possible incorporating mechanical facial area seals (usually ceramic and carbon mating rings) held jointly by a spring, coupled with significant-high quality, multi-layered or precisely formulated elastomer components (like HNBR or FKM rubbers). These State-of-the-art seals are made to:

oWithstand larger temperatures and pressures typical in modern day engines.

oMaintain sealing integrity in the course of swift temperature fluctuations (chilly begins to hot jogging).

oResist degradation from advanced coolant additives and possible contaminants.

oOffer substantially lengthier assistance daily life before weeping or leaking occurs when compared to older types. The reference to Guanseal possible factors to a particular large-functionality seal maker or structure philosophy centered on longevity.

RM European (standard Paper Gaskets/one-Layer Seals): though RM European likely works by using dependable mechanical seals internally, their housing-to-block sealing may well rely upon far more traditional solutions dependant upon the distinct software and layout era. more mature patterns may well use dealt with paper gaskets or standard single-layer rubber O-rings or gaskets. although helpful when new, these resources is often more susceptible to:

oCompression established with time (dropping their sealing drive).

oBecoming brittle or cracking as a consequence of heat cycles and age.

oDegradation from intense coolant chemistries or contamination.

oHigher chance of leakage, particularly all through chilly starts or Extraordinary significant-rpm/superior-force eventualities, when compared with State-of-the-art multi-component sealing techniques.

Surface solutions and Corrosion Protection

Beyond the base content, floor treatment plans Enjoy a significant position in longevity, specifically for aluminum housings.

FREY (Anodizing): FREY highlights using anodizing for its aluminum housings. Anodizing electrochemically converts the aluminum area into a layer of strong, tough, corrosion-resistant aluminum oxide. This layer is integral to your steel (not simply a coating) and gives:

oExcellent defense in opposition to oxidation and chemical assault from coolant.

oIncreased area hardness, providing some wear resistance.

oA thoroughly clean, eco-friendly procedure when compared with some paints.

RM European (Paint/Coatings or normal complete): Cast iron pumps are frequently painted (e.g., with epoxy paint) to circumvent exterior rust and provide a concluded appearance. While successful at first, paint levels can chip or peel after a while resulting from warmth, vibration, or impacts, probably exposing the fundamental iron to corrosion In case the coolant inhibitors fall short. Composite pumps generally demand no supplemental corrosion safety. Some high-conclude pumps across the marketplace (referenced by Wikipedia regarding typical engineering) may well use specialised coatings like phosphate conversion coatings and even abradable powder coatings on interior surfaces to improve clearances and strengthen performance, however this is usually reserved for top quality purposes.
